Mobile wallets are strictly web wallets. They need to connect with remote nodes.
For any new coin with self hosted blockchain, a desktop wallet would be the first thing to consider. Desktop are the devices that gets involved in mining.
Mobile wallet are just for ease if the coin gets a huge popularity. And anything called mining in phone are just simulations.
